The Chang’an Grand Theatre is a renowned time-honored theater. It was originally built in 1937 and was located in the bustling Xidan commercial street in Beijing. The new theater reopened in September 1996 and was relocated to Guanghua Chang’an Building on the north side of East Chang’an Street. The new Chang’an Grand Theatre is a perfect combination of classical national architectural style and modern architectural art.


Its design and decoration have a typical Ming and Qing style. The Chang’an Grand Theatre mainly stages classic plays, especially performances of various art forms represented by Peking Opera. These plays, on the basis of retaining the original flavor of traditional operas, pursue to reflect the cultural atmosphere that changes with the times. It enables more famous actors and experts in the opera field and opera fans to conduct academic exchanges through the stage of Chang’an.
